Lomo Instant Wide Review

Lomo Instant Wide Review

Posted on February 1, 2016March 28, 2020 By Jarvis

Introduction

Lomo has enjoyed great success bringing analogue cameras back into the mindset of cool photographers around the world, and with this latest instant camera, you get the fun of film, but without the long wait for processing. The Lomo Instant Wide is the second Instant camera from Lomo, the first featuring a 27mm lens and using the Fuji Instax Mini Film. This one, rather than having a wide angle lens (as the name might suggest), uses the Fujifilm Instax Wide film. There’s actually a 90mm f/8 lens (35mm equivalent), but it can be bought as part of a Combo package which has an Ultra Wide-Angle Lens attachment (21mm equivalent). The Combo package also includes a Close-Up lens, and a “Splitzer” for exposing only parts of the frame for multiple-exposure shots. Other specifications of note include a tripod mount, exposure compensation settings, a filter thread of 49mm and a lens cap which doubles up as a remote control.
